Output 1dd2316b2392dadaca655f9f2df26c2763f0e19732cd4a2f015a6993d6a3788c:1

value
3674072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8134271939f4418379a773c6c2ac949b8fe789ef OP_EQUAL
address
3DUBZvbvrVgRV68Rrx7fvJPKSRnqVQVoGa
transaction
1dd2316b2392dadaca655f9f2df26c2763f0e19732cd4a2f015a6993d6a3788c
confirmations
447508
spent
true